Quote:
Originally Posted by Geremia View Post
"isKRFDRendererSupported = false" has no effect for me with Kindle 1.31.0 and 1.26.0 under Wine 6.11.

It appears in these regedit paths for me:

H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Amazon\Kindle\User Settings
H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Wow6432Node\Amazon\Kind le\User Settings
Are you setting this prior to running K4PC? If you haven't set the permissions on the registry entry to prevent it from being overwritten, K4PC will reset it during it's startup. That is why the batch file deletes that value, waits for K4PC to recreate it and then modifies it.
